Two new midfield combinations line up opposite each other in tonight's third test between the All Blacks and France
23 June 2018
New Zealand have veteran Sonny Bill Williams and test debutant Jack Goodhue while the visitors have switched to the Clermont Auvergne duo of Remy Lamerat and Wesley Fofana
While Jack Goodhue is the most inexperienced of the quartet, first five Richie Mo'unga backs him to hold his own.
He says in his opinion Goodhue is probably one of the best midfield defenders in the world with his ability to make tackles and maintain a cool head despite his age.
